Output 66a34715777faed8b09928bd92f717a688c3116d4453e49c795214b6bb942e01:1

value
11431600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b62eb1f34d2c01dcc9c15eca101557d19c365eca OP_EQUALVERIFY OP_CHECKSIG
address
1HcHvM7rVqie6MGsw8dfvUnS3J4v4MVnHZ
transaction
66a34715777faed8b09928bd92f717a688c3116d4453e49c795214b6bb942e01
spent
true